    It is a fantastic rural location, just right for people who want to get away from it all. But still within a reasonable distance from the Brecon Beacons National Park (Pen y Fan, Waterfalls) and Hay-On-Wye (2nd hand bookshop capital of the UK). The local pub in Erwood, the Wheelwright's Arms does great food and has a nice atmospheere.
